1. OBJECTIVES

·         To grant an efficient and accountable way of managing the project through effective management and decision-making structures, while retaining a high level of representation and transparency, both with regard to the scientific and the financial aspects.

·         To carry out, on behalf of the beneficiaries, the specific coordination tasks laid down in the Grant Agreement (GA) with the Commission, covering all scientific, technical organizational and financial aspects.

 
2. DESCRIPTION OF WORK AND ROLE OF PARTICIPANTS

The following aspects can be distinguished in the management activities: organizational activities and actions undertaken to disseminate, promote and exploit the knowledge connected with the project.

1.      Organizational activities

They consist of:

·         promotional activities towards the persons in charge for the work packages (activity leaders), to further the implementation of the work packages, to monitor their progress, to monitor the expenditures according to the implementation plan, to foster the flow of information within the project;

·         contacts with the beneficiaries of the GA (persons in charge for administrative and scientific aspects);

·         contacts with the Nuclear Physics European Collaboration Committee (NuPECC), presenting reports on the progress of the project, in occasion of the periodic meetings of this organization;

·         contacts with the Commission – Project Officer, Financial Officer, Legal Offices, others – for discussions related the management of the project;

·         contacts with the community – members of the collaborations, Directors of Institutes, researchers;

·         implementation, formal constitution, entering into force of the managerial bodies which constitute the managerial structure of the project;

·         organization of periodical meetings of the Management Board (4 per year);

·         organization of periodical meetings of:

­ -   Collaboration Committee (twice a year)
­-   Dissemination Board (once a year)
­-   Governing Board (once a year)
­-   Council (once a year)
­ -   Scientific Advisory Committee(once a year)

·         Preparation of the Periodic Report:

­ -   finalization of the Activity Report,

­ -   finalization of the Financial Part of the Periodic Report and the Form C for each beneficiary.

2.      Actions undertaken to disseminate, promote and exploit the knowledge connected to and derived from the project

The main objectives in the dissemination effort are:

  • to achieve visibility for the project and its findings across Europe and worldwide, both within and outside the scientific community;
  • to encourage the view that the deployment of hadron physics is important, both scientifically and culturally;
  • to promote the awareness of science as “part of the fabric of society”;
  • to gain increased knowledge and sharing of HadronPhysics2 activities and achievements in the society of science and new technology;
  • to recruit and encourage the next generation of scientists.
 

The actions undertaken by the management are:

  • presentation of the project in International Conferences and Workshops;
  • presentation of the project and its progress to NuPECC, to receive advices and suggestions;
  • presentation of the project in restricted and public seminaries, organized by the major European organizations;
  • co-sponsorships of International Conferences and Workshops covering subjects related to the scientific objectives of the project;
  • organic cooperation with European Centers of excellence in the hadron physics field, theory and experiments:

­    identification of common fields of cooperation considered as beneficial in the interest of both, like the co-organization of workshops focused on subjects having a direct relationship to the activities of the project;

­    implementation of joint positions to contribute to the dissemination of knowledge in the field of hadron physics;

·         promotion of actions to be performed within the individual organizations to publicize research activities and its recent achievements and the knowledge derived from the project;

·         implementation of the project website:

among the means to promote and exploit the knowledge derived by the activities of the project, a crucial role is played by the project website.

This fundamental tool was created by the management of the consortium already in FP6 and was fully re-styled for FP7.
